Active IQ Level 2 Award in Mental Health Awareness
The purpose of this qualification is to provide learners with an understanding and awareness of mental health, common mental health disorders and issues, help reduce stigma and discrimination and encourage people to talk about mental health. Furthermore, the qualification should provide learners with the ability to apply their knowledge of mental health through recognising and responding to the signs of mental ill health in themselves and others and be able to offer mental health first aid to people experiencing mental ill health.
This qualification combines both theoretical elements and practical application. It aims to increase awareness of mental health, including what it is, how it can change and how common mental health, ill health is and to reduce stigma and discrimination. In addition to this, the qualification also equips you with the basic skills to carry out the procedures of mental health first aid and be able to respond appropriately when others are experiencing a mental health crisis.
This course will cover the following conditions:
Depression
Anxiety disorders: stress, phobias and post-traumatic stress disorder
Schizophrenia
Eating disorders: anorexia nervosa and bulimia nervosa
Addiction and substance misuse
Bereavement
Self-harm

Mandatory units
Mental health awareness
Mental health first aid
Learning outcomes
Understand mental health
Understand mental health disorders
Understand the support and advice
available for mental ill health
Assessment criteria
Recognise and respond to the signs of mental ill health in themselves and others
1.1 Define mental health
1.2 Describe the mental health continuum
1.3 Outline stigma and discrimination in relation to mental ill
health
1.4 Identify common misconceptions surrounding mental
health
1.5 Describe the role of the media in the portrayal of mental
health
1.6 Outline key statistical data in relation to mental health
1.7 Outline the duty of care
2.1 Identify the main signs and symptoms of common mental
health disorders and mental health problems to include:
Depression
Anxiety disorders: stress, phobias and post-traumatic
stress disorder
Schizophrenia
Eating disorders: anorexia nervosa and bulimia
nervosa
Addiction and substance misuse
Bereavement
Self-harm
2.2 Identify common treatments and interventions used to
manage mental health and mental ill health
2.3 Describe the main risk factors associated with mental ill
health
3.1 Identify credible sources of information, support and
guidance
3.2 Identify credible organisations offering support services
3.3 Identify appropriate responses that can be made to
support someone with mental ill health
1.1 Recognise the signs of mental ill health
1.2 Provide initial help to a person experiencing mental ill
health
1.3 Signpost appropriate sources of help
1.4 Escalate situations when a person may be at risk of harm
to themselves or others
1.5 Promote good mental health
